This year I decorated with a winter wonderland theme, using natural touches of sage green, soft white, silver and grey throughout.
I love fresh greens, however it can get expensive so I mix in a lot of faux greenery throughout. I used my Mother’s pewter tea set server that she passed down to me to hold the flowers. My parents always had the set proudly displayed in they’re living room and I am so glad I can now do the same!
I used beautiful hand-painted and hand-decorated blown glass pieces in silver and soft sage from Balsam Hill, the perfect addition to our tree this year!
